Résumé

"Exploring the World of Online Reviews" delves into the fascinating realm of digital critique, shedding light on the profound influence that online reviews wield in today's consumer-driven world. From deciphering the psychology of reviewers and the impact of cognitive biases to unraveling the intricate web of fake reviews, astroturfing, and review bombing, this book offers a comprehensive exploration of the dynamics surrounding product/book success and trust.  Delving deep into the ethics of incentivized reviews, corporate manipulation, and reviewer disclosure, it also offers insights into the policies and practices of major review platforms.
As we journey through the pages, we envision the future of reviews in a world increasingly shaped by technology and consumer behavior, all while reflecting on case studies that illustrate the pivotal role reviews play in shaping the fate of products and books. Whether you're a curious consumer, an aspiring reviewer, or a savvy businessperson, this book will equip you with the knowledge to navigate the ever-evolving landscape of online reviews.
